Red Flags For Ductwork Repair
Keeping your ductwork in top condition is crucial for maintaining a comfortable and energy-efficient home. Over time, ductwork can become damaged or deteriorated, leading to a variety of problems. Knowing when it's time for a system checkup can help you avoid costly repairs down the road. Here are some telltale signs that your ductwork may need attention :
- Noticeable leaks around your vents or in your attic
- Increased energy bills
- Unusual noises coming from your ductwork
- Poor airflow throughout your home
- Frequent bouts of sneezing, coughing, or wheezing
If you notice any of these symptoms, it's important to schedule a professional ductwork assessment . A qualified HVAC technician can pinpoint the problem and recommend the best course of action, whether it's simple repairs or a full overhaul.

Importance of Sealed and Insulated Ductwork
Properly sealed and insulated ductwork is vital for a efficient HVAC system. When your ducts are compromised, conditioned air can escape into the walls, reducing heating and cooling effectiveness. This leads to higher energy bills and decreased comfort levels. Insulation helps to reduce heat transfer within your ductwork, maintaining conditioned air at the intended temperature and improving overall system operation.
Common Ductwork Problems and Their Solutions
Maintaining a properly operating HVAC system often involves identifying and addressing frequent ductwork problems. One prevalent problem is damaged ducts, which can reduce airflow efficiency and raise energy bills. Examining your ductwork frequently for symptoms of leaks, such as debris buildup or drafts, is crucial.
To fix leaks, consider patching them with metal tape.
- Another common problem involves inadequate insulation. Poorly insulated ducts can cause heat loss during the winter and heat gain during the summer, affecting your system's performance. To optimize insulation, consider adding foam insulation to your ductwork.
- Additionally, improperly sized ducts can hinder airflow, leading to inefficient heating and cooling. Having a professional ductwork specialist to assess your ductwork size and recommend any necessary adjustments is essential.
